Overview: dissociative disorders, schizophrenia, childhood disorders (textbook 622-625) Dissociative disorders: involve disruptions in consciousness, memory, identity, or perception: depersonalization/derealization disorder, dissociative amnesia, dissociative identity disorder. World may be fake or estranged: characterized by multiple episodes of one or both of depersonalization and derealization, disruption in perception of reality and self.
